Hindsight is always 20/20, but in looking back over this past year, I discovered two things about the personality of the buyers actively involved in the market here on the Outer Cape. Buying real estate is now a desirable long term investment, and they are making a lifestyle choice for personal and their family futures. There has been a building of pent up demand on those who can buy after sitting on the sidelines during the economic changes. As well, there is a willingness to participate in the market due to buyers watching the market carefully. Sellers are attracting attention because they are willing to negotiate with price reductions, yet some are confined to their homes for not willing or unable to cut prices. Issues of value pricing, home condition, location, and how much home they should own have been the criteria used to encourage their participation.

 

In the high end market, homes/condos which have sold are selling on average at 12% under assessed price, and some 25% off the original listing price. Beneficiaries of the current market are sellers who correctly positioned the price of their home creating value to buyers matching their lifestyle and investment interests. Monthly statements from banks are being replaced with buyers looking to enjoy secondary homes over the next several years,  they have redefined their idea of value, and 11% of second home buyers will eventually make that second home their primary residence.

 

It’s hard to predict the future market, but we continue to be optimistic based on the activity during the second half of 2011. With interest rates at historic lows, buying power is tremendous.
